The United Arab Emirates has always been at the forefront of urban innovation, and with its 2040 master plan, the nation is setting a global benchmark for sustainable, technologically advanced cities. Unlike past urban development projects that emphasized luxury and rapid expansion, the new vision focuses on balancing growth with environmental responsibility, long-term sustainability, and smarter living spaces. This forward-thinking approach is not just about constructing buildings but about creating communities that thrive in harmony with nature and embrace the power of artificial intelligence and smart technology.
The UAE Real Estate 2040 Vision is more than a government roadmap—it is a promise to residents, investors, and global stakeholders that the country is committed to shaping a livable, resilient, and future-ready urban environment. With cities like Dubai and Abu Dhabi already renowned for their skyscrapers and world-class infrastructure, the new phase will be marked by an even greater emphasis on sustainable housing, green public spaces, digital governance, and advanced mobility solutions.
At the heart of the UAE’s 2040 plan lies a deep commitment to sustainability. The government has pledged to make cities more human-centered, greener, and resilient to the challenges posed by climate change. This will involve expanding green corridors, increasing urban farming, and creating more walkable neighborhoods.
Real estate developers are being encouraged to design with a focus on energy efficiency and low-carbon construction materials. Solar panels, green rooftops, and natural ventilation systems are becoming standard features in residential and commercial developments. By 2040, the UAE aims to ensure that every community offers not just housing but a lifestyle that aligns with eco-conscious living.
This push towards sustainability is also aligned with the nation’s Net Zero 2050 initiative. By integrating renewable energy into real estate projects and ensuring waste reduction through circular economy practices, the UAE is ensuring its developments are both future-proof and environmentally responsible.
One of the defining aspects of the 2040 vision is the integration of artificial intelligence in city management. From smart traffic systems that reduce congestion to AI-powered energy grids that optimize consumption, technology is at the core of the transformation.
Developments are now being equipped with Internet of Things (IoT) sensors that monitor everything from air quality to water usage. These insights help city planners and residents make informed decisions, ensuring efficiency and sustainability in daily life. For example, AI-driven waste management systems can predict collection needs, while predictive maintenance ensures that infrastructure remains in top condition without costly downtime.
Beyond efficiency, AI will also personalize the urban experience. Smart homes will interact seamlessly with city services, and digital twins of urban areas will allow planners to simulate future developments before construction even begins. This digital-first approach ensures that every investment is data-backed and resilient to future needs.
The UAE has long been associated with luxury real estate, but the 2040 plan redefines luxury through the lens of sustainability. Developers are merging cutting-edge architecture with eco-friendly design. Luxury villas with solar rooftops, eco-parks integrated within residential clusters, and water recycling systems in high-rise towers are becoming the new standard.
For international investors, this creates a unique proposition: properties that combine world-class amenities with long-term ecological value. By 2040, owning a home in Dubai or Abu Dhabi will not just be about prestige, but also about being part of a larger commitment to environmental stewardship.
The UAE’s 2040 vision also emphasizes the creation of more inclusive and accessible green spaces. Parks, recreational zones, and waterfront developments are planned across urban and suburban areas, ensuring that nature remains at the heart of city life.
Urban planners are focusing on wellness-driven designs, with cycling tracks, pedestrian-friendly zones, and community gardens. This aligns with the global trend of “biophilic design,” which highlights the importance of integrating nature into everyday urban environments. By prioritizing residents’ physical and mental health, the UAE is building cities that go beyond concrete and steel.
Another critical area of the UAE’s 2040 urban strategy is mobility. As populations grow and urban areas expand, transportation systems need to evolve. Autonomous vehicles, electric public transport, and AI-driven traffic management will define the next generation of mobility in the UAE.
Dubai’s Roads and Transport Authority has already introduced autonomous taxis and pilot programs for drone taxis. By 2040, such innovations will no longer be experimental but mainstream. Real estate developments will be designed with integrated mobility hubs, reducing reliance on private vehicles and making daily commutes faster, cheaper, and cleaner.
This future mobility ecosystem will also directly influence property values. Communities with better access to efficient transport systems will attract higher demand, making mobility innovation a cornerstone of the UAE’s real estate growth.

Despite the ambitious blueprint, challenges remain. Balancing rapid growth with environmental goals will require constant vigilance. Developers may face higher initial costs for sustainable projects, and ensuring affordability across housing segments will be key.
Moreover, adapting to rapid technological change demands continuous investment in infrastructure, education, and governance. The UAE must ensure that innovation does not leave behind vulnerable communities and that inclusivity remains at the heart of city development.
Yet, the nation’s proven track record of delivering world-class projects suggests that these challenges will be met with resilience and adaptability.
